Preheat your oven to 400 degrees F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Peel and slice the carrots into diagonal rounds about half an inch thick.
In a bowl, toss the carrots with 0.25 tbsp of olive oil, the maple syrup, and a pinch of sea salt.
Spread the carrots on the baking sheet and roast for 20-25 minutes until tender and caramelized.
Season the chicken breast evenly on both sides with sea salt, black pepper, and garlic powder.
Heat the remaining 0.25 tbsp of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at and sear the chicken for 6-7 minutes per side until the internal temperature reaches 165 degrees F.
While the chicken rests, toast the pecans in a small dry pan over medium heat for 2 minutes until fragrant.
Plate the seared chicken alongside the roasted carrots, then garnish with the toasted pecans and fresh thyme leaves.
